Pokhara feels like a breath of fresh air after the chaos of Kathmandu, especially if you love waking up to the mirror‑like surface of Phewa Lake. The Lakeside area, where most backpackers set up camp, is packed with cafés that spill onto the promenade and cheap guesthouses perched on steep staircase...
